All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Whitehall Road area has the 12th highest crime rate of 27 local areas in Homewood , and the 187th lowest crime rate of 454 local areas in Swale .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Whitehall Road (ME10 4HB) in the last 12 months was 53.0 per 1,000 residents and was 49.5% higher than the Homewood average (35.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 7 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2024.
Violent crimes totalled 8 (≈ 26.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 33.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-9.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Whitehall Road (ME10 4HB), the main crime hotspot is near Cobham Avenue. Police recorded 29 crimes here, including 7 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
